Choosing the Right Plants for Your Living Room
The first step to successful living room plant decor is selecting plants that will thrive in your specific environment. Consider these factors:
Light: Living rooms typically have a good amount of indirect sunlight. However, some areas may receive more direct sun, especially near south-facing windows. Identify the light conditions in your living room and choose plants accordingly. Low-light tolerant plants like Snake Plants (Sansevieria) and ZZ Plants (Zamioculcas zamiifolia) are perfect for dimly lit areas, while succulents and cacti can handle brighter light.
Maintenance: Consider your lifestyle and how much time you can dedicate to plant care. Some plants, like ferns and calatheas, require more frequent watering and higher humidity levels. Others, like air plants and bromeliads, need less frequent watering.Size: Think about the scale of your living room and choose plants that will complement the size of the space. Large plants like Fiddle Leaf Figs (Ficus lyrata) can add drama to a spacious living room, while smaller plants like African Violets (Saintpaulia) are ideal for side tables or bookshelves. Living Room Plant Placement Ideas
Once you have your plants, it’s time to consider creative placement strategies to maximize their visual impact and create a sense of harmony in your living room:
Focal Points: Large plants like Fiddle Leaf Figs or Monstera Deliciosa can act as stunning focal points, especially when positioned near windows or in empty corners.
Vertical Gardens: Utilize vertical space with hanging plants, climbing vines on trellises, or wall-mounted planters. This is a great strategy for small living rooms.Grouped Arrangements: Create a lush, miniature jungle by grouping plants of varying heights and textures on coffee tables, side tables, or ottomans. Tiered Plant Stands: Elevate smaller plants to eye level using tiered plant stands. This adds visual interest and dimension to your living room decor.Bookshelves and Cabinets: Empty shelves and cabinets provide the perfect platform to display a collection of succulents, cacti, or air plants. Pro Tips for Living Room Plant Decor Success
Planter Selection: Planters play a significant role in living room plant decor. Choose planters that complement the style of your living room and the plant itself. For a modern aesthetic, geometric ceramic planters or sleek metal planters are good options. Rustic woven baskets or natural fiber planters suit a bohemian style.
Drainage: Ensure proper drainage to prevent root rot. Most planters have drainage holes; if not, use a decorative pot with a drainage saucer underneath.Light Rotation: Rotate your plants regularly to ensure even growth, especially if they are positioned near a single light source.Repotting: As your plants mature, they may need to be repotted into larger containers.
